Stories of Traditional Art Told at Souq El Fostat Fashion Show


Sun 09 Apr 2023 | 10:57 PM
By Pasant Elzaitony

A two-day Ramadan celebration was held in the Souq El Fostat in Old Cairo under the title "Hekayat EL Fan Masry".

It also featured the play of the flute, tabla, and folk arts.

The celebration concluded with a very special fashion show by designers of fashion, art designers, jewelry, bags, and handicrafts.

The fashion show aims to highlight the efforts and stories of Egyptian art, which is displayed throughout the year in 40 galleries in Souq El Fostat.

* Nahed Amin

The show kicked off with designer Nahed Amin presenting her designs under the title of "Fun".

She relied on the Khayamiya traditional art as well as on high-end materials and cotton fabrics.

Amin presented designs in distinctive new colors and added astras and embroidery to them.

* Jihan Al-Majd

Designer Jihan Al-Majd was the second to present her designs.

Al-Majd showcased the item under the title of "Love". She combined the Egyptian arts with love and mixed the little details, relying on the integration of ideas and their simplicity.

* Marwa and Dalia Ibrahim

It's beautiful for two sisters to have art as a common ground.

This is what sisters Marwa and Dalia Ibrahim showcased with their exquisite designs.

They presented their designs under the title "Gallery Dar".

The designs were made from fine cotton materials and came delightful summer filled with modern details and a youthful vibe.

They also presented tie-and-dye art and crochet works.

* Sinai art

Sinai region is beloved by many of us in the homeland, where art and handicrafts are original and inspiring.

The designer Iman Sinawi and the artist Bashir Alorgani, famous by Bashir al-Sinawi, presented designs that blend civilization, art, and sophistication at the same time.

* Samar batik

The ancient art of batik has fans. This art does not reveal its secrets except to those its loves and discloses to them its secrets, abilities, and energies.

This is what happened between the art of batik and the artist Samar Hassanein, who presents very creative art and modern designs of dresses, jumpsuits, and jackets Komono made of Egyptian batik art.

* Al-Tali shandawil

Al-Tali is a wonderful art that has been inherited by generations, and the Sa'idi artist Amal Sayed Hassan got acquainted with this art after she finished her studies and decided to revive this art with love and make designs in various colors away from black and white such as blue.

She surprised many after presenting a wedding dress entirely made of off-white tally and gold threads.
